Output 66d592ef8639233caae3af8aedd4b3503d43e70b2352b8fbdf3ce1ca1332412b:1

value
170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d475337238d0b1aa272901d4bbc2230d98f7a04 OP_EQUALVERIFY OP_CHECKSIG
address
158QrPJCvcXmpQ364zregqerJo6VY3MAwV
transaction
66d592ef8639233caae3af8aedd4b3503d43e70b2352b8fbdf3ce1ca1332412b
spent
true